A computational tool designed to automate the process of determining a bowler’s final score based on frame-by-frame performance is the subject of this discussion. These tools accept input representing pins knocked down in each frame and calculate the cumulative score, accounting for strikes and spares which carry scoring implications into subsequent frames. For example, inputting a strike in the first frame followed by five pins in the second frame and then two pins would result in a score calculation reflecting the bonus points earned from the strike.

These automated systems provide an efficient and accurate alternative to manual calculation, minimizing the risk of error often associated with traditional scoring methods. Historically, bowling scores were tallied by hand, requiring significant attention to detail and creating opportunities for miscalculation, especially when dealing with multiple strikes or spares. The advent of automated scorekeeping systems, including those integrated into bowling alley equipment and standalone applications, has greatly enhanced the bowler’s experience, allowing greater focus on technique and strategy. This also provides a convenient means for bowlers to analyze their performance data over time, aiding in skill improvement.

The process of finding a standardized score using a TI-84 calculator allows for the determination of how many standard deviations a data point is from the mean of its distribution. For example, given a dataset with a mean of 70 and a standard deviation of 5, if a specific data point is 78, a TI-84 can be utilized to efficiently compute the associated standardized score, revealing its relative position within the data.

Determining a standardized score has utility in statistical analysis, hypothesis testing, and comparing data points from different distributions. Historically, manual calculations were time-consuming and prone to error. The integration of statistical functions into calculators streamlines this process, enabling faster and more accurate data interpretation. This capability is particularly beneficial in academic research, quality control, and fields requiring data-driven decision-making.

A method for evaluating the size and quality of a whitetail deer’s antlers uses specific measurements, assigning a numerical value reflective of these attributes. This evaluation typically involves assessing the length of the main beams, the spread between the antlers, tine lengths, and circumference measurements at designated points. These measurements are then incorporated into a standardized formula. As an illustration, a scorer might measure the main beam length on both antlers, add the inside spread measurement, and include the lengths of all points exceeding one inch. These values are then tallied based on the applicable scoring system.

The practice of quantifying antler size is important for several reasons. It provides hunters with a benchmark for comparing trophies and documenting their success. Additionally, scoring data is valuable for wildlife management, enabling biologists to track population trends and assess the overall health and genetic potential of deer herds. This data has been collected and analyzed for decades, providing a historical record of antler development across different regions and time periods. Early methods often involved manual measurement and calculation, leading to potential inconsistencies.
